Form SSA-454-BK is used to collect data about medical and non-medical sources, updated work status, educational/vocational training, and current activities of daily living.
It is designed to collect information during a continuing disability review (CDR). It asks about the current status of your condition since the date of the last favorable medical disability decision. The last decision becomes what Social Security calls the "Comparison Point Decision" (CPD).
The form is also used to collect information if you apply for Expedited Reinstatement (EXR) of disability benefits.
